Judy Chicago (1939-), American

FEMALE REJECTION DRAWING #3 (PEELING BACK) (FROM THE REJECTION QUINTET, 1974), 1977

Colour offset lithograph on wove paper; signed and dated 1977 in pencil to margin. Published by Periwinkle Productions, Beverly Hills, 1974.
Sheet sight 28" x 21.75" — 71.1 x 55.2 cm.

Estimate $300-$500

Realised: $660

Note:

The 1970’s saw a period of progression in which women powerfully contested the patriarchy. Chicago combines jewel-like colours with autobiographical text. This work, with its vulvic iconography, seeks to dislodge the cultural primacy of the phallus.
